PerformanceCounterType 列舉

定義

指定直接對應到原生類型的效能計數器類型。

public enum class PerformanceCounterType
public enum PerformanceCounterType
[System.ComponentModel.TypeConverter(typeof(System.Diagnostics.AlphabeticalEnumConverter))]
public enum PerformanceCounterType
type PerformanceCounterType = 
[<System.ComponentModel.TypeConverter(typeof(System.Diagnostics.AlphabeticalEnumConverter))>]
type PerformanceCounterType = 
Public Enum PerformanceCounterType
繼承
PerformanceCounterType
屬性

欄位

AverageBase 1073939458

基底計數器型別,用於計算時間或計數平均,例如 AverageTimer32AverageCount64。 儲存計算計數器的分母,以表示「每個作業時間」或「每個作業次數」。

AverageCount64 1073874176

平均計數器,顯示在作業期間已處理項目的平均數量。 這個型別的計數器會顯示已處理項目對已完成作業數量的比例。 藉由比較最新間隔期間所處理的項目數量與最新間隔期間所完成的作業,可以計算比例 這類計數器包含 PhysicalDisk\ Avg.Disk Bytes/Transfer。

AverageTimer32 805438464

平均計數器,測量完成處理序或作業的平均使用時間。 這個型別的計數器會顯示樣本間隔的總耗用時間與此期間所完成處理序或作業數量的比例。 這個計數器型別會以系統時鐘的刻度為單位來測量時間 這類計數器包含 PhysicalDisk\ Avg.Disk sec/Transfer。

CounterDelta32 4195328

差異計數器,顯示在最近兩次的樣本間隔間的測量屬性之變更。

CounterDelta64 4195584

差異計數器,顯示在最近兩次的樣本間隔間的測量屬性之變更。 它和 CounterDelta32 計數器類型相同,但是使用較大的欄位來容納較大值。

CounterMultiBase 1107494144

基底計數器,表示取樣的項目數量。 當要取得多個類似項目的時間時,它會做為計算的分母來取得取樣項目的平均。 與 CounterMultiTimerCounterMultiTimerInverseCounterMultiTimer100NsCounterMultiTimer100NsInverse 一起使用。

CounterMultiTimer 574686464

百分比計數器,將一個或多個元件的作用時間顯示為樣本間隔的總時間百分比。 因為分子會記錄同時運作的元件的作用時間,所以產生的百分比可以超過 100 %。 這個計數器型別不同於 CounterMultiTimer100Ns,因為它是以系統效能計時器的刻度為單位來測量時間,而不是以 100 奈秒 (Nanosecond) 為單位 這個計數器型別是多重計時器。

CounterMultiTimer100Ns 575735040

將一或多個元件的作用時間顯示為樣本間隔的總時間百分比的百分比計數器。 它會以 100 奈秒為單位來測量時間。 這個計數器型別是多重計時器。

CounterMultiTimer100NsInverse 592512256

將一或多個元件的作用時間顯示為樣本間隔的總時間百分比的百分比計數器。 這個型別的計數器會以 100 奈秒 (ns) 為單位來測量時間。 它們會藉由測量元件的非作用時間,並將 100 % 乘以監視物件數量的乘積減去非作用時間,來取得作用的時間。 這個計數器型別是反向多重計時器。

CounterMultiTimerInverse 591463680

將一或多個元件的作用時間顯示為樣本間隔的總時間百分比的百分比計數器。 它會藉由測量元件非作用時間,並將 100 % 乘以所監視物件數量的乘積減去非作用時間,來取得作用的時間。 這個計數器型別是反向多重計時器。 它和 CounterMultiTimer100NsInverse 不同,因為後者測量時間的單位是系統效能計時器的刻度,而不是 100 奈秒。

CounterTimer 541132032

百分比計數器,將元件使用中的平均時間顯示為總耗用時間的百分比。

CounterTimerInverse 557909248

百分比計數器,顯示樣本間隔期間所觀察的作用時間之平均百分比。 這些計數器的值是由監視服務非作用時間百分比,並且將 100 % 減去該百分比所計算而來。 這是反向計數器型別。 它會以系統效能計時器的刻度為單位來測量時間。

CountPerTimeInterval32 4523008

平均計數器,設計來監視一段時間內資源的佇列平均長度。 它會顯示在最新的兩個樣本間隔期間,所觀察佇列長度之間的差異值,再除以間隔的持續時間。 這個計數器型別通常用於追蹤佇列或等候的項目數。

CountPerTimeInterval64 4523264

平均計數器,監視一段時間內資源的佇列平均長度。 這個型別的計數器會顯示在最新的兩個樣本間隔期間,所觀察佇列長度之間的差異值,再除以間隔的持續時間。 這個計數器型別和 CountPerTimeInterval32 相同,但是它使用較大的欄位來容納較大的值。 這個計數器型別通常用於追蹤大量佇列或等候的項目數。

ElapsedTime 807666944

差異計時器,顯示元件或處理序啟動時間和計算這個值的時間之間的總時間。 這類計數器包含 System\ System Up Time。

NumberOfItems32 65536

顯示最近觀察到的值的即時計數器。 例如,用來維護項目或作業的簡單計數。 這類計數器包含 Memory\Available Bytes。

NumberOfItems64 65792

顯示最近觀察到的值的即時計數器。 例如,用來維護極大量項目或作業的簡單計數。 它和 NumberOfItems32 相同,但是它使用較大的欄位來容納較大的值。

NumberOfItemsHEX32 0

即時計數器,以十六進位格式顯示最近觀察到的值。 例如,用來維護項目或作業的簡單計數。

NumberOfItemsHEX64 256

顯示最近觀察到的值的即時計數器。 例如,用來維護極大量項目或作業的簡單計數。 它和 NumberOfItemsHEX32 相同,但是它使用較大的欄位來容納較大的值。

RateOfCountsPerSecond32 272696320

差異計數器,顯示在樣本間隔每秒期間完成的作業平均數。 這個型別的計數器會以系統時鐘的刻度為單位來測量時間 這類計數器包含 System\ File Read Operations/sec。

RateOfCountsPerSecond64 272696576

差異計數器,顯示在樣本間隔每秒期間完成的作業平均數。 這個型別的計數器會以系統時鐘的刻度為單位來測量時間 這個計數器型別和 RateOfCountsPerSecond32 型別相同,但是它使用較大的欄位來容納較大的值,以便追蹤每秒大量的項目數或作業數,例如位元組傳輸速率。 這類計數器包含 System\ File Read Operations/sec。

RawBase 1073939459

基底計數器,儲存表示一般算術分數的計數器的分母。 請在將這個值當做 RawFraction 值計算中的分母之前,先檢查這個值是否大於零。

RawFraction 537003008

即時百分比計數器,以百分比顯示子集對其集合的比例。 例如,它會比較磁碟的使用中位元組數和磁碟的總位元組數。 這個型別的計數器只會顯示目前的百分比,而不是一段時間的平均 此類型的計數器包括分頁檔案\% 使用量尖峰。

SampleBase 1073939457

基底計數器型別,儲存取樣中斷數,並在取樣分數中做為分母。 取樣分數就是樣本數目,其對樣本中斷而言為 1 (或 true)。 在將這個值當做 SampleFraction 計算中的分母之前,請先檢查這個值是否大於零。

SampleCounter 4260864

平均計數器,顯示一秒鐘完成的作業平均數。 當這個型別的計數器取樣資料時,每個取樣中斷會傳回 1 或 0。 計數器資料是所取樣的數目。 它會以系統效能計時器的刻度為單位來測量時間。

SampleFraction 549585920

百分比計數器,顯示在最新兩次樣本間隔期間的對所有作業點擊的平均比例。 這類計數器包含 Cache\Pin Read Hits %。

Timer100Ns 542180608

將一或多個元件的作用時間顯示為樣本間隔的總時間百分比的百分比計數器。 它會以 100 奈秒為單位來測量時間。 這個型別的計數器是設計來一次測量一個元件的活動 此類型的計數器包括 Processor\% User Time。

Timer100NsInverse 558957824

百分比計數器,顯示樣本間隔期間所觀察的作用時間之平均百分比。 這是反向計數器。 此類型的計數器包括 Processor\% Processor Time。

備註

如需此 API 的詳細資訊,請參閱 PerformanceCounterType 的補充 API 備註

適用於

另請參閱